Перейти до вмісту
Пошук в
  • Детальніше...
Шукати результати, які ...
Шукати результати в ...

Tsyvatsok

Новачок
  
  • Публікації

    27
  • З нами

  • Відвідування

Відвідувачі профілю

Блок відвідувачів профілю відключений і не буде доступний широкому іншим користувачам

Tsyvatsok's Achievements

Explorer

Explorer (4/14)

  • First Post
  • Collaborator
  • Week One Done
  • One Month Later
  • One Year In

Recent Badges

0

Репутація

  1. Подскажите, как можно настроить валидацию полей для страницы оформления заказа? Индекс не содержит буквы, ФИО не содержит цифры и тд?
  2. Привет всем, хотел узнать, может кто-то сталкивался с такой проблемой: на двух сайтах стоит абсолютно одинаковый модуль Яндекс.YML для генерации YML. Однако, с одного сайта он генерирует нормально YML, а на другом генерирует не из всех категорий и товарах. Как видно, ни одна категория не выбрана, я пробовал выбирать все и не выбирать не одну, однако все равно генерируются не все товары. Я проверил файлы модуля - они абсолютно идентичны. Не знаю, в чем может быть проблема, возможно, кто-то сталкивался с подобным? PS: По какой то причине запуск скрипта php ./export/yandex_yml.php не работает на сайте, на котором все нормально генерируется.
  3. Стоит ваш шаблон и фильтр, однако, в фильтре отображаются только 3 производителя, хотя на самом сайте их намного больше. В чем может быть проблема? Производители включены, у них проставлены seo_tag и картинки, за ними закреплены товары, которые есть на складе и включены. В других опциях на фильтрацию есть строчка "Показать все", однако, даже если изменить тип опции производителя с checkbox на select, в нем все равно будет только три производителя. Копался в БД, разницы между этими тремя производителями и другими так и не нашел.
  4. Огромное Вам спасибо! А в чем была проблема, можете подсказать? Поскольку, regex я юзал как в доках описано, да и переменные все правильные были. Дело в версии апача? Просто разбирался долго очень и писал разными путями и через %{HTTP} off и не могу понять почему моя версия была нерабочая.
  5. Пробовал верхний вариант, редиректит рекурсивно Нижний вариант вроде работает, за что спасибо Вам огромное, но не перенаправляет с www на без www
  6. Сделал как сказали, в итоге такой результат: В htaccess строчки RewriteCond %{HTTP_HOST} ^(www)?\.(.*)$ [NC] RewriteRule ^(.*)$ https://%2/$1 [R=301,L] 1)ЗАКОМЕНЧЕНЫ. Результат: http://сайт/test.php редиректа НЕТ http://www.сайт/test.php - без редиректа http://сайт/ - первый раз без редиректа, если нажать F5 идет редирект на https:// http://www.сайт - без редиректа, F5 ничего не дает. 2)РАСКОМЕНЧЕНЫ http://сайт/test.php редиректа НЕТ http://www.сайт/test.php - редирект на https://сайт/test.php, причем в таком порядке http://сайт/ - первый раз загружается без редиректа, если нажать F5 идет редирект на https://. Что за фигня... Причем спецом отключил кэширование редиректов и все равно подобное поведение http://www.сайт/ - сразу редиректит на https://сайт .
  7. Даже если полностью закоментить RewriteEngine все равно идет редирект с http на https, по идее где то внутри OpenCart'а идет редирект с кодом 200, но никак не могу найти где именно.
  8. Попробовал перенести строки - все равно возвращает код 200. Насчет констант я понимаю, но на сервере константа HTTP уже прописана с HTTPS протоколом по какой то не понятной причине .
  9. Столкнулся с такой проблемой: на самом сайте стоит ssl сертификат и редирект с www на без www. Вот по сути все редиректы в htaccess: RewriteBase / RewriteRule ^sitemap.xml$ index.php?route=extension/feed/google_sitemap [L] RewriteRule ^googlebase.xml$ index.php?route=extension/feed/google_base [L] RewriteRule ^system/download/(.*) index.php?route=error/not_found [L] R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teCond %{REQUEST_URI} !.*\.(ico|gif|jpg|jpeg|png|js|css) RewriteRule ^([^?]*) index.php?_route_=$1 [L,QSA] RewriteCond %{HTTP_HOST} ^www\.(.*)$ [NC] RewriteRule ^(.*)$ https://%1/$1 [R=301,L] Однако, 301 код возвращают только запросы на www. адреса (неважно какой протокол). В самом config.php в качестве HTTP_SERVER переменной был задан сайт сразу с https протоколом, тот же адрес был продублирован в HTTPS_SERVER. Замена в HTTP_SERVER переменной протокола на http ничего не изменяет вообще. Пробовал уже и сам писать редиректы и что только не делал, единственное что помогло - заменить HTTP_SERVER адрес на https://www. чтобы правило автоматом работало на все https протоколы и в предпоследней строчке данного htaccess заменить условие на %{HTTPS_HOST} ... Но метод очень кривой и делать по 1000 редиректов не камильфо. Может кто знает в чем может быть проблема? Пытался отключить в настройке сервера "Использовать SSL" - все летит к чертям (если только в HTTP_SERVER не стоит протокол https заранее). Думаю может ещё дело в SEO или в кэше SEO но трогать боюсь чтобы индексацию не поломать.
  10. Может кто сможет подсказать: при оформлении заказа открывается новая вкладка (на которой по идее должен выводится номер заказа и тд) но там пусто, ничего не выводится. Пробовал включать вывод ошибок в админке, но страница все равно пустая. В логах пусто, в controller/checkout/success.php все вроде нормально
  11. Подскажите, пожалуйста. В мобильном меню кликабельные только знаки стрелок, клик на сами названия полей ничего не делают, может, кто-нибудь знает, как это исправить? Я так понимаю они через JS реализованы, возможно через evenListener, но весь JS код в одну строчку, не говоря уже о том, что я особо в нем не секу. Плюс иногда меню появляется не все, а только шапка без других кнопок и намертво зависает (помогает только перезагрузка страницы, X не работает. Может кто может помочь или подтолкнуть в правильном направлении? Спасибо.
×
×
  • Створити...

Important Information

На нашому сайті використовуються файли cookie і відбувається обробка деяких персональних даних користувачів, щоб поліпшити користувальницький інтерфейс. Щоб дізнатися для чого і які персональні дані ми обробляємо перейдіть за посиланням . Якщо Ви натиснете «Я даю згоду», це означає, що Ви розумієте і приймаєте всі умови, зазначені в цьому Повідомленні про конфіденційність.